The Liouville theorem as a problem of common eigenfunctions

arXiv:1503.06789

Abstract

It is shown that, by appropriately defining the eigenfunctions of a function defined on the extended phase space, the Liouville theorem on solutions of the Hamilton--Jacobi equation can be formulated as the problem of finding common eigenfunctions of constants of motion in involution, where is the number of degrees of freedom of the system.
